Smokers Veins . Smokers stand at a much higher risk of being afflicted with varicose veins and other vascular issues. Smoking and vein disease are often related. In fact, smoking is a key underlying risk factor for the development of vein disease. The immediate effects of smoking include vasoconstriction or narrowing of the veins.
